my blueberry plants are growing in 7'' high by 5'' diamter pots, will this be large enough until i find out the sex?
I would say that all depends on how large you want to grow your plants. If you plan on keeping them really small then I would say those pots are fine. My plants are only 8-9" tall and already they have been transplanted into 2gallon pots. The pots you are talking about are probably like the ones that I started with and under good conditions they would be ready to transplant after 3-4 weeks.
Cronaholic's right on this one--unless you want small plants or wanna risk your plants getting rootbound, consider re-potting in the near future. My plants are two weeks and some change and I just repotted them from 10" terra cotta pots(about 1.5gallons) into 5-gal pots less than an hour ago. While doing so I saw that the roots had already made their way through a good 65% of the soil.
Those should be adequate for a while. Just check the bottom drainage holes for when you start seeing root tips. As soon as this happens, change the pots out for bigger ones.
